Creating a Portable Emergency treatment Package: What to Include for On-the-Go Safety

A mobile emergency treatment package ought to be small yet comprehensive adequate to handle common emergency situations. Below are necessary items that every mobile package must include:

1. Glue Bandages

    Purpose: To cover small cuts and abrasions. Tip: Consist of different dimensions for various injuries.

2. Sterilized Gauze Pads and Adhesive Tape

    Purpose: To dress injuries that may bleed. Tip: Choose gauze pads that feature adhesive borders for simple application.

3. Antiseptic Wipes or Solution

    Purpose: To clean injuries and prevent infection. Tip: Alcohol wipes are effective but might sting; consider alternatives like saline solution.

4. Tweezers

    Purpose: To remove splinters or ticks safely. Tip: Opt for fine-tipped tweezers for much better precision.

5. Scissors

    Purpose: To reduce tape or clothing away from an injury. Tip: Use blunt-tipped scissors for safety.

6. Stretchable bandage (e.g., Ace bandage)

    Purpose: To give assistance for strains or strains. Tip: Ensure it's adjustable and simple to wrap around limbs.

7. Pain Relievers (e.g., Ibuprofen or Acetaminophen)

    Purpose: To relieve pain from small injuries or headaches. Tip: Examine expiry dates consistently and replace as needed.

8. Immediate Cold Packs

    Purpose: To lower swelling from sprains or strains. Tip: These are terrific for on-the-go use considering that they trigger easily.

9. First Aid Manual or Direction Booklet

    Purpose: To lead you through usual procedures. Tip: Maintain it succinct but insightful; take into consideration including QR codes connecting to video clip tutorials.

Emergency Reaction Protocols: Fire Extinguisher Operation

Equipping on your own with understanding concerning fire extinguisher procedure matches your portable set completely when encountering prospective fire risks:

1) Pull the pin 2) Goal reduced at the base of the fire 3) Squeeze the handle 4) Move side-to-side till the flames extinguish
